Abstract :
In the context of coding the displaced frame difference signal, morphological segmentation is an alternative to linear methods such as the DCT. Although offering attractive features: edge preservation and lack of ringing, it can introduce artefacts such as spurious edges in the reconstructed video sequence. In this paper, a smoothing algorithm is described that reduces this problem and yields significant subjective quality improvement
